Tender description

Crown Estate Scotland, on behalf of SOWEC, is seeking to appoint a consultancy to provide a number of management and other associated services (SIM Management Service Provider) to the SIM for an initial period of 12 months. During the first 6 months, the SIM Management Service Provider will be contracted to Crown Estate Scotland (CES) who is procuring this on behalf of the group pending the new legal entity (SIM legal vehicle) being created. Once the SIM legal vehicle has been established, it is intended that the contract with CES will be novated to the new SIM legal vehicle and will continue for the remainder of its term. If the SIM Management Service Provider has demonstrated sufficient value during this initial contract period, the expectation is that the contract will be extended for a further 12 months. The decision to extend will be solely at the discretion of the SIM legal vehicle or, if such has not yet been established, Crown Estate Scotland Management of the SIM is likely to be required longer term and beyond the periods described above. It will be for the SIM legal vehicle or the CFWG at that time to determine the appropriate arrangements for the services required once this appointment has expired. The primary function of the SIM Management Service Provider will be to present investment opportunities on strategic projects for consideration to the CFWG, through the to be established, legal structure of the SIM (Deliverable 1). This will be drawn from information received and requested to enable an initial assessment to be made; and further detail then collated which allows potential investors to make informed decisions about progressing funding opportunities. Governance and reporting is to be established for the SIM, through to the CFWG and SOWEC. The identification of major capital-intensive projects and progressing those identified are the immediate priorities of SIM Stage 1. It is expected that sources of strategic investment will need to be identified and factored into proposals from mid-2023 to maximise the economic value of future offshore wind farms in Scotland and further afield. As CFWG members have been working towards these dates for some time, there are already concepts and proposals in development. The SIM Management Service Provider will be responsible, by Summer 2023, for facilitating the compilation of these proposals, to be agreed by the CFWG. This then represents an initial collective view on the major Scottish port and infrastructure projects which are to be prioritised for strategic offshore wind investment (Deliverable 2). This initial view can evolve and be reactive to additional opportunities or refocus. Supplementary data in support of the initial recommendations will be requested, collated, and presented. The aim shall be, by end 2023, to have a robust and comprehensive definition of initial major projects to be pursued, with investment prospectuses concluded and transitioned to stage 2. (Deliverable 3). For its first year, as noted, the SIM legal vehicle will focus on major port infrastructure projects. However, the intention is to expand SIM activities into other areas such as supply chain, people & skills and innovation. By the end of 2023, the SIM Management Service Provider, with the CFWG, shall have developed a view on what those areas should be together with a comprehensive justification in support of it (Deliverable 4).
